I was at that game. Needless to say, we were shocked at the events that night. After the game a rather large gang of us waited outside the Garden to stone the Bruin bus. We anointed an (American) Indian as our leader...we called him the Chief. We were chanting “O’Reilly sucks”, “O’Reilly sucks”, “O’Reilly sucks”, “Iran Sucks”, “Iran Sucks” (this was just after they took our hostages), and finally “O’Reilly’s From Iran”. That last one really fired us up.

In the end, the police tricked us and the Bruin bus managed to sneak out of a different exit (from under the Garden).

It was quite a night, and thankfully it ended without anyone else getting hurt and major damage done...but we were in a frenzy.

Those really WERE the days. I remember going to a game at the old Garden and after just some short exhortation from the crown in the form of “Get Green..get Green..” chants, the Rangers jumped the evil Teddy Green and beat the crap out of him.

Those old arenas were great. You would walk into the old MSG from an outside corridor and be greeted by a haze of cigar and cigarette smoke, and the olfactory equivalent of a fraternity house the day after a big kegger party. Only a few of the goalies wore masks, and none of the players. To be high behind a goal and watch Gilbert, Ratelle, and Hadfield rushing toward you was magic for a young hockey fan. Today, you need to take a second mortgage on your house to afford tickets, and TV timeouts ruin the game live.
